Engage young students in creative writing and historical exploration with these art and history-inspired prompts related to The Amber Room.
The Amber Room Quest: Write a story about a young art enthusiast who goes on a quest to uncover the mysteries of The Amber Room, encountering historical artifacts and challenges along the way.
Artistic Interpretation: Imagine being an artist commissioned to create a painting or sculpture inspired by The Amber Room. Describe your artistic process and the emotions evoked by the legendary treasure.
Historical Time Travel: If you could travel back in time to witness the creation or disappearance of The Amber Room, what would you see? Write a detailed account of this historical adventure.
Mystery of The Amber Room: Craft a mystery story involving a group of young history buffs who attempt to solve the puzzle of The Amber Room's vanishing and uncover its hidden secrets.
The Amber Room Artifacts: Create a fictional diary entry from the perspective of a curator or historian responsible for preserving artifacts related to The Amber Room. Describe the challenges and significance of this responsibility.
The Amber Room Time Capsule: Write a futuristic story about a time capsule containing clues and artifacts from The Amber Room that is discovered by young archaeologists in the distant future.
The Amber Room Heist: Pen a thrilling tale about a daring museum heist involving The Amber Room. Explore the motives and tactics of the mastermind behind this high-stakes crime.
The Amber Room Restoration: Imagine being part of a team tasked with restoring The Amber Room to its former glory. Describe the challenges and triumphs of this monumental artistic and historical undertaking.
The Amber Room Haunting: Craft a ghost story set within the walls of a museum or historical building housing remnants of The Amber Room. Explore the eerie connections between the past and present.
The Amber Room Odyssey: Write a narrative poem or epic inspired by the legendary journey of The Amber Room, incorporating themes of art, history, and the passage of time.
